Günther Apfalter is a businessperson who has been at the helm of 8 different companies. Mr. Apfalter occupies the position of Chairman-Supervisory Board at SWARCO AG, Managing Director at SWARCO Traffic Holding GmbH, Chairman-Supervisory Board of Magna Steyr AG & Co. KG, Chairman-Supervisory Board at Magna Metalforming AG, Chairman-Supervisory Board of Magna Steyr Fahrzeugtechnik AG & Co. KG, Co-Managing Director at Magna International Automotive Holding GmbH, Co-Managing Director at MAGNA Automotive Europe GmbH and President for Magna Europa AG. Günther Apfalter is also on the board of LEONI AG, Magna Powertrain AG & Co. KG, MAGNA Powertrain GmbH and MAGNA Metalforming GmbH and President-Magna Europe & Asia at Magna International Europe GmbH. In his past career Mr. Apfalter occupied the position of Head-Agricultural Machinery Division at Steyr Daimler Puch AG and Managing Director at Case Germany GmbH.
